Adam Trese
This has been a favorite of mine ever since it opened in 2002. The food is always prepared fresh and fast and the owner and her staff are exceptionally charming and welcoming. Though, it’s a small place, it is very comfortable and there is good, but tight, free parking in front. It’s perfect for a warm, home cooked lunch, especially during these colder months. My favorite dish at the moment may be their drunken noodles and I’ve enjoyed all the curries (I usually order extra rice) and their large bowl noodle soups throughout the 2-3 years I’ve been coming. They make delicious Thai iced coffee year round if you’re craving something sweet. I can’t believe I forgot to leave a review all this time. I’ve made myself hungry. Enjoy!

We dined in at the restaurant and the atmosphere was very cozy and the staff was super welcoming. There is a beautiful mural that spans the whole back wall and some gorgeous framed paintings up on the other walls, which we came to learn were all painted by one of the cooks. Talent chef and artist!

So on to the food… now my wife and I are former residents of Flushing Queens. For those that don’t know, it’s THE place to get Asian food so our standards are high and Neung Thai Kitchen did not disappoint!!

We started with the curry puff, chicken satay, and shrimp rolls which were all delicious. I especially loved the shrimp roll, deep fried spring roll with shrimp inside? Sign me up!

For entrees I had the massaman curry which was phenomenal and my wife had the tom yum soup, which she said was the best she’s ever had. Coming from her that is high praise for sure!
